BIOGRAPHY

Neil Jordan is a celebrated Irish filmmaker known for his distinct storytelling style and a knack for blending genres. He gained international acclaim with "The Crying Game" (1992), which not only earned him an Academy Award for Best Original Screenplay but also solidified his status as a visionary director. Collectors treasure this film for its groundbreaking narrative and cultural impact, often seeking out limited edition releases on both DVD and Blu-ray. His later work, "Greta" (2019), showcases his ability to craft suspenseful, character-driven stories, drawing collectors who appreciate the film's unique blend of psychological thrill and drama. What is Neil Jordan best known for in his film career?

Neil Jordan is best known for directing a range of films including dramas, thrillers, and fantasy, with notable titles like The Crying Game and Interview with the Vampire.

During which decade was Neil Jordan most active in filmmaking?

Neil Jordan was most active during the 2000s, directing several films throughout that decade.

What genres does Neil Jordan typically work in?

Neil Jordan's work spans multiple genres including drama, thriller, documentary, crime, comedy, and fantasy.

Has Neil Jordan ever appeared as himself in any film?

Yes, Neil Jordan appeared as himself in the 2011 film Muide Éire.
